India, Dec. 27 -- Delhi NCR-based tea-cafe chain Chaayos reduced its net loss by 50.59% to INR 54 Cr in the financial year ended March 2024 (FY24) from INR 109.3 Cr in FY23, as it cut its expenses and turned EBITDA profitable.

However, the decline in loss came at the cost of subdued growth in its top line. Chaayos' operating revenue rose a mere 4.89% to INR 248.6 Cr during the year under review from INR 237 Cr in FY23.
Including other income, total revenue grew 7% to INR 271.2 Cr in FY24 from INR 253.4 Cr in the previous fiscal year.
